What Causes Iron in Well Water?

Iron is the fourth most abundant element in the Earth's crust. In central Ohio, the limestone and shale geology means groundwater naturally picks up dissolved iron as it moves through rock and soil.

There are two main forms of iron in well water:

Ferrous iron (dissolved / "clear water iron") — Iron that's dissolved in the water. The water looks clear when it comes out of the tap, but turns orange or brown when it's exposed to air and oxidizes. This is the most common form in central Ohio wells.

Ferric iron (particulate / "red water iron") — Iron that's already oxidized. The water looks orange or brown directly from the tap. Less common but more immediately visible.

Iron bacteria — A third type that's not actually iron itself, but bacteria that feed on iron and produce a slimy, rust-colored biofilm. If you see orange slime in your toilet tank or a musty/swampy smell alongside the rust color, iron bacteria may be present.

Most central Ohio well water problems involve ferrous iron, sometimes combined with manganese (which produces black or dark brown staining).

What Iron Water Does to Your Skin and Nails

Orange Tint on Skin

Ferrous iron oxidizes on contact with air — including the air on your skin. After showering in iron-rich water, you may notice:

  • A faint orange or yellowish tint on skin, particularly on lighter skin tones
  • A metallic smell that lingers on skin after showering
  • Dry, irritated skin (iron disrupts the skin's natural pH and can act as an oxidative stressor)

The orange tint usually washes off with soap, but the underlying irritation accumulates with repeated exposure.

Nail Discoloration

This is one of the most common complaints we hear from well water customers. Iron in shower water causes:

  • Yellow, orange, or brownish staining on fingernails and toenails
  • Staining that's difficult to remove with nail polish remover or scrubbing
  • Brittle nails over time (iron deposits interfere with the nail's moisture balance)

Many women spend money on nail treatments trying to fix discoloration that's being caused — and re-caused — by every shower. The staining returns within days because the source hasn't been addressed.

Skin Irritation and Dryness

Iron-rich water is more oxidatively active than clean water. For people with sensitive skin, eczema, or rosacea, iron water can:

  • Increase skin inflammation and redness
  • Worsen existing skin conditions
  • Cause a persistent metallic or "off" smell on skin

Combined with Columbus & Central Ohio hard water (which is also present in many well water sources), the effect on skin can be significant.

What Iron Water Does to Your Laundry

This is often the first place homeowners notice an iron problem — before they connect it to their skin and nails.

White and light-colored fabrics develop orange, rust, or yellow staining that worsens with each wash. The iron deposits into fabric fibers and oxidizes, creating permanent-looking stains.

Towels and bedding are particularly vulnerable because they're washed frequently in hot water, which accelerates iron oxidation.

Bleach makes it worse. This is a critical point: using chlorine bleach on iron-stained laundry sets the stain permanently. If you've been trying to bleach out orange laundry stains, stop immediately — you're making them harder to remove.

To remove existing iron stains from laundry, use a product containing oxalic acid (like Iron Out or similar) before washing. But again, this treats the symptom. The staining will return with every wash until the iron is removed from the water supply.

What Iron Water Does to Your Home

Beyond skin and laundry, iron causes visible damage throughout the home:

  • Orange/rust staining in sinks, tubs, showers, and toilets
  • Clogged pipes and fixtures — iron deposits build up inside pipes over time, reducing water pressure and eventually causing blockages
  • Appliance damage — water heaters, dishwashers, and washing machines accumulate iron deposits that reduce efficiency and shorten lifespan
  • Stained dishes and glassware — a persistent orange film on dishes even after washing
  • Discolored ice — if your refrigerator has an ice maker, iron water produces orange-tinted ice

How Much Iron Is Too Much?

The EPA's secondary standard for iron in drinking water is 0.3 mg/L (300 ppb). This is a non-enforceable aesthetic standard — iron at this level isn't considered a health hazard, but it causes the staining and taste issues described above.

Many central Ohio wells test at 1–5 mg/L or higher — well above the aesthetic threshold. At these levels, staining is severe and the metallic taste is pronounced.

A professional water test will tell you your exact iron level, which determines what type of treatment system is appropriate.

What Actually Removes Iron from Well Water

Iron Breaker Filter (Katalox Light Media)

For central Ohio well water, we install the Iron Breaker system using Katalox Light filtration media. This is the most effective residential iron removal technology available.

Katalox Light works through catalytic oxidation — it converts dissolved ferrous iron to particulate ferric iron, then filters it out. Unlike older iron filter media (birm, greensand), Katalox Light:

  • Removes iron up to 15 mg/L (handles even high-iron wells)
  • Also removes manganese and hydrogen sulfide (the rotten egg smell)
  • Requires no chemical addition — no potassium permanganate, no chlorine injection
  • Backwashes automatically with air and water
  • Has a 10+ year media lifespan

The result is water that's clear, odor-free, and won't stain your skin, nails, laundry, or fixtures.

What About Iron Filters at the Hardware Store?

Whole-house iron filters sold at big box stores use basic sediment or carbon media that's not designed for dissolved iron removal. They may reduce particulate iron slightly but won't address ferrous iron — the most common form in central Ohio wells.

For well water with iron above 0.5 mg/L, a purpose-built iron filter with appropriate media is required.
